BILLINGS - While about 200 union members returned to work at the East Boulder Mine this weekend, about 200 union employees are still without a job following restructuring of the Stillwater Mining Company.

The restructuring also includes a cut in production for next year. Before the economic slow down, Stillwater Mining officials projected they would harvest about 525,000 ounces of platinum and palladium between their two mines. They're now expecting to harvest 490,000 ounces.

The biggest cuts come from the East Boulder Mine where they're expecting to harvest about 60,000 fewer ounces than last year. John Beaudry with the Stillwater Mining Company says these changes should help them through the rough economic times.

"We think we and be cash neutral or slightly cash positive with this restructuring plan and for the next 18-to-24 months get through the current economic situation," Beaudry said. Beaudry added that the company hopes to increase production when the price of metal goes back up.
